Output ed96405d95af12068b4deb357df8d4a20d1e507b70b6dda25554b9adcf58b278:42

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 950f20c9375bdcb7a09028dc63f3812d36d7eb04
address
tb1qj58jpjfht0wt0gys9rwx8uup95md06cy6dmu05
transaction
ed96405d95af12068b4deb357df8d4a20d1e507b70b6dda25554b9adcf58b278